Transaction ebf660bfde42d860f92c8e2959a43afefada51ced3c7e9eef50da05fd9e9a7fc
1 Input
1 Output
-
ebf660bfde42d860f92c8e2959a43afefada51ced3c7e9eef50da05fd9e9a7fc: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6d0ffb16c37fa70f4fc299681984f14c9d91e2c55adfb1523a6fbfa95d4002f9
- address
- bc1pd58lk9kr07ns7n7zn95pnp83fjwerck9tt0mz536d7l6jh2qqtus8j690a